タグ内のすべてのコンテンツを定期的に照合する
タグ内のすべてのコンテンツを照合する方法を教えてください。詳細は次のとおりです。<br />$neirong='addddaa<a href=http://localhost/xiaozu/zhutiimage/2014624/18.jpg><img class="img-rounded" src=http://localhost/xiaozu/zhutiimage/2014624/18.jpg ></a>gggggg';<br /><br />$tihuanzi='/<a href=(.*) >(.*)<\/a>/';<br /> $wenzi="";<br /> $neirongyu = preg_replace($tihuanzi,$wenzi,$neirong);<br /><br /><br />
置換は失敗します。代わりはありません。以下のことを教えてください。
-----解決策------ --------------
明らかにスペースの問題です
a と href の間を見てください。
の前に > があります。
に一致する s* をスペースに入れます------解決策-----------------------
$tihuanzi='/ (.*)/';
ルール文字列
'/(. *)/'
^ここにはスペースが 1 つだけあります
そして元の文字列
^ここにはスペースが 2 つあります